  • Patent number: 8551672
    Abstract: A packaging structure of a low-pressure molded fuel cell comprises a hot melt adhesive layer, which is formed through a low-pressure molding process using a hot melt adhesive that has specific material properties and will become molten when being heated. The molten hot melt adhesive is injected into the cell via injection holes formed on a housing or a mounting element to flow through a C-sectioned flow channel, so as to tightly enclose and bond to edges of the air cathode and separator for the cell. After the hot melt adhesive is solidified, a chemical-resistant hot melt adhesive layer with good sealing and enclosing ability as well as high adhesion strength and elasticity, being bubble removed at controlled pressure and the hot melt adhesive material is formed to firmly bond to the cell components and tightly seal the cell, so as to effectively prevent electrolyte in the cell from leaking.

    Abstract: Synthetic doors composed a rectangular frame with of skins of compression molded sheets secured to opposite sides of the frame and a core of foamed plastics with a window light therein are improved with a novel glazing cleat for securing a window light in an aperture in such a door that includes plate that rests against edges the skins about the aperture, the plate having an upright rim engaging a face of a window light and downwardly directed flanges which, with tangs on a retainer member having a upright tab engaging the opposite face the window light when nesting with the plate sandwiches the skins between the flanges and tangs to take advantage of the mechanical strength of the skins. Further if a fire resistant plate is married to internal face of each skin, the cleat will take advantage of the mechanical strength of such plates in supporting the window light in the case of fires, even if the outer or exterior skin or skins are turned to ash by a fire.

  • Publication number: 20110131921
    Abstract: Using integrally formed stiles on skins of sheet molded plastics (thermosetting) employed to form the exterior surfaces of a synthetic door having sheets of reinforcing materials adhered to the inner surface of each of the skins, the skins can be connected through the integral stiles and slats of a fire proof materials can be affixed to these stiles and rails closing the top and bottom opening between the skins to increase the fire resistance of the resulting door when the core is filled with a phenolic foam. The structure described reduces the weight of the resulting door and places the fire resistant materials around the door edges which are the most susceptible to failure during a fire while structurally tying the slats together through the sheets of carbon fiber or fiberglass disposed on the inner surfaces of the skins whereby failure (disintegration) of the skins during a fire will not lead to a collapse of the door as with some prior art door structures.

  • Publication number: 20110061322
    Abstract: A trimmable pigmented door product trimmed without coloration variations comprising two identical same pigmented compression molded skins (11, 12) by face to face assembled each other, each pigmented skin is composed by weight of 12% to 20% polyester resin, 6% to 13% styrene monomer, 3% to 6% polystyrene, 36% to 54% calcium carbonate and 16% to 28% chopped fiber glass to blend in different percentages with pigmented components selected from the group consisting of titanium oxide, ferric oxide, organic green pigment, organic blue pigment and carbon black, so that a trimmable pigmented door product having different colors and trimmed without loss of the integrity of the skin can be obtained and particularly has the feature that if scratched and abraded the scratches and abrasions on the skin are not apparent.

  • Patent number: 7887956
    Abstract: An air cathode having a multilayer structure is composed of at least one substrate, two diffusion layers and three activation layers. The two diffusion layers are laminated over an upper side of the substrate and a lower side of the substrate. The three activation layers are respectively laminated over one of the two diffusion layers in order. Different loadings or different kinds of catalysts are added into a slurry to form the activation layers, and the activation layers and the diffusion layers are made through simultaneous sintering, thereby shortening the processing time. When the air cathode is used as the cathode of the Zinc-Air battery, the electrolyte inside the Zinc-Air battery will not be influenced by the outside air, and the problem of maintaining the water content of the zinc anode of the Zinc-Air battery can be efficiently overcome.
